Using the remote with any UI client for NextPVR can be the most important part of the user experience. While uidroid will work with just a DPAD and return key,I feel the more keys the better, since it reduces the reliance on long presses and can give more functionality. As an example music playback is not possible without the "Play" key. Be careful, if you touch the Home or dedicated keys like Netflix these will kick you out of NextPVR.

Here is the basic key board reference https://github.com/emveepee/Testing/wiki...dReference Basically the way this reference works is look at the standard remote reference column and if your remote has that key use it. If not check check the Roku or Android columns for additional capabilities

It is also important is to make this change in config.xml to get document skipping behaviour on DPAD Left and Right

<LeftRightBehaviour>Long Skip</LeftRightBehaviour>

The default number of seconds skipped (60/30) can also be configured in config.xml

New users to NextPVR based UI clients may not know the skipping mechanism but sub's has a great implementation where you can enter the number key for the the number of minutes to skip and the arrow key.

If you want more keys and can add USB RF dongle there are many in the $20 range on Amazon that work with no configuration or you can add a Bluetooth remote like the Sofabaton for full control (but you would need to configure it too.

Also to access the settings menu in Android it is long DPAD centre when video is not playing.

If you need help configuring a remote post here however if you need help with specific IR based remote make a separate post with you logcat logs hitting the keys that don't work.

Just got the uidroid interface installed on a Chromecast with GoogleTV (CCGTV) and I very happy with it.  One of the issues I'm trying to work through is configuration of the Google TV soft remote from the Google Playstore

As mentioned, I'm running uidroid on a CCGTV.  From my testing, the core functions work (ie, dpad control and all the buttons that are on the physical CCGTV remote)

Where I am running into problems is with the Google TV soft remote keyboard.  I am running am LG G8 and using the Gboard Keyboard.

When I navigate to Search in uidroid and start typing, the characters appear in uidroid in the search input box, but several of the letters do not interpret correct.  When type the word "house", it appears as "hopse".  The "u" is translated as a "p".  Also, since the CCGTV has the voice capability, when on search and I say "house" it is interpreted as "hopse"

I tested all the characters on a qwerty keyboard, top row first, left to right.
Expected: qwertyuiopasdfghjklzxcvbnm
Actual: q'$t!piopasdghjkl"%sbnm
Note: f and c keys did not display a result nor did the space bar.

When I exit uidroid, open the Youtube app on the CCGTV, navigate to search and type "house" it interprets as "house".

When testing the NextPVR Windows app, executing the same test scenario as attempted on the CCGTV, "house" is interpreted as "house"

It seems it is a keyboard mapping issue.  Is there any way for me to config uidroid for the Google TV remote keyboard?

I picked up a cheap remote from Amazon and for one day use I am pretty impressed with the uidroid use.    It the G20S PRO and it has both BT and a 2.4 wireless receiver so it will pretty much work with all configurable Android devices. 

Right now the one I bought is $13 US free shipping on Amazon.  The one I got the box is unbranded but Amazon said JIEBA.  As is typical on Chinese devices there are other brands and higher prices for the G20S plus and it is nearly impossible to say if they are better or not.  There are many h/w varieties too.

It is about 3/4" longer then the TivO but thinner so I prefer this size.  The DPAD is a nice size too.   So the ONN + this remote for $33 compares pretty well with the TiVo 4K at $30 when it is on sale (as it is now)

Pros

- all keys work in uidroid. 
- air mouse in BT and 2.4 mode
- more logic keyboard then the TivO
- backlit

Cons

- in BT mode many keys are not standard in need to be defined. I will be posting a clientstore setup but might build it in if there is support. Definitions mapping are the same in on multiple BT devices though.
- might not support CEC, but the power and mute button can be reprogrammed from Android default.
- defaults to mouse on on start up and after Android screensaver.
- info/context at bottom right

Pro or Con? 
- no dedicated Netflix, Prime buttons.
